問題內容

我正在開發一個 Go 項目,在該項目中,我使用 sqlboiler 從我使用 setup.sh 腳本創建的 SQLite3 資料庫生成程式碼。我遇到了一個似乎無法解決的錯誤。錯誤訊息是:

graph/db/repositories.go:998:23: cannot use o.CreatedAt (variable of type string) as driver.Valuer value in argument to queries.MustTime: string does not implement driver.Valuer (missing method Value)
graph/db/repositories.go:999:23: cannot use &o.CreatedAt (value of type *string) as sql.Scanner value in argument to queries.SetScanner: *string does not implement sql.Scanner (missing method Scan)

當我嘗試在 graph/db/repositories.go 檔案中使用 time.Time 值時,會發生此錯誤。我正在為我的專案使用 golang:1.21-alpine3.18 Docker 映像。

我嘗試更改 SQLite3 資料庫的儲存庫表中的created_at 列類型。我已經使用 TEXT 和 TIMESTAMP 資料類型對其進行了測試,但錯誤仍然存在。

有誰知道可能導致此錯誤的原因以及如何解決它?

解決方法

我會說更新 Go 中的儲存庫結構,將 CreatedAt 作為 time.Time 欄位。 將值指派給 CreatedAt 時,請使用 time.Time 值。例如, currTime := time.Now() 讓你的結構像這樣

type Repository struct {
    ID        string    `boil:"id" json:"id" toml:"id" yaml:"id"`
    Owner     string    `boil:"owner" json:"owner" toml:"owner" yaml:"owner"`
    Name      string    `boil:"name" json:"name" toml:"name" yaml:"name"`
    CreatedAt time.Time `boil:"created_at" json:"created_at" toml:"created_at" yaml:"created_at"`
    // other fields...
}

然後設定 CreatedAt 值:

repository := &Repository{
    ID:        "some-id",
    Owner:     "owner-id",
    Name:      "repo-name",
    CreatedAt: time.Now(), // setting it as time.Time
}
